■PHP
hash_hmac('md5', $str, 'key');
■Python
import hmac from hashlib import sha1 from hashlib import md5 hmac.new("key", "value", md5).hexdigest() hmac.new("key", "value", sha1).hexdigest()
■Android
public class HmacMD5 {
private static final String ALGORISM = “HmacMD5”;
private static final String S = “key”;
public static String get(String str) {
SecretKeySpec secretKeySpec = new SecretKeySpec(S.getBytes(), ALGORISM);
try {
Mac mac = Mac.getInstance(ALGORISM);
mac.init(secretKeySpec);
byte[] result = mac.doFinal(str.getBytes());
return byteToString(result);
}
catch (NoSuchAlgorithmException e) {
e.printStackTrace();
}
catch (InvalidKeyException e) {
e.printStackTrace();
}
return “”;
}
private static String byteToString(byte [] b) {
StringBuffer buffer = new StringBuffer();
for (int i = 0; i < b.length; i++) {
int d = b[i];
d += (d < 0)? 256 : 0;
if (d < 16) {
buffer.append("0");
}
buffer.append(Integer.toString(d, 16));
}
return buffer.toString();
}
}

■iOS
日本語入力に対応するためにstackoverflowから持ってきたコードに少々手を入れた。
+ (NSString *)HMACMD5WithKey:(NSString *)data
{
const char *cKey = [@”key” cStringUsingEncoding:NSUTF8StringEncoding];
const char *cData = [data cStringUsingEncoding:NSUTF8StringEncoding];
const unsigned int blockSize = 64;
char ipad[blockSize];
char opad[blockSize];
char keypad[blockSize];
unsigned int keyLen = strlen(cKey);
CC_MD5_CTX ctxt;
if (keyLen > blockSize) {
CC_MD5_Init(&ctxt);
CC_MD5_Update(&ctxt, cKey, keyLen);
CC_MD5_Final((unsigned char *)keypad, &ctxt);
keyLen = CC_MD5_DIGEST_LENGTH;
}
else {
memcpy(keypad, cKey, keyLen);
}
memset(ipad, 0x36, blockSize);
memset(opad, 0x5c, blockSize);
int i;
for (i = 0; i < keyLen; i++) {
ipad[i] ^= keypad[i];
opad[i] ^= keypad[i];
}
CC_MD5_Init(&ctxt);
CC_MD5_Update(&ctxt, ipad, blockSize);
CC_MD5_Update(&ctxt, cData, strlen(cData));
unsigned char md5[CC_MD5_DIGEST_LENGTH];
CC_MD5_Final(md5, &ctxt);
CC_MD5_Init(&ctxt);
CC_MD5_Update(&ctxt, opad, blockSize);
CC_MD5_Update(&ctxt, md5, CC_MD5_DIGEST_LENGTH);
CC_MD5_Final(md5, &ctxt);
const unsigned int hex_len = CC_MD5_DIGEST_LENGTH*2+2;
char hex[hex_len];
for(i = 0; i < CC_MD5_DIGEST_LENGTH; i++) {
snprintf(&hex[i*2], hex_len-i*2, "%02x", md5[i]);
}
NSData *HMAC = [[NSData alloc] initWithBytes:hex length:strlen(hex)];
NSString *hash = [[[NSString alloc] initWithData:HMAC encoding:NSUTF8StringEncoding] autorelease];
[HMAC release];
return hash;
}
